如何使用Java SE和Apache POI将一个完整的Excel工作表复制到同一工作簿的另一个Excel工作表中?
您可能需要工作簿上的cloneSheet(sheetNumber)方法 . 有关详细信息,请参阅JavaDocs
你检查了API吗?
要将工作表复制到 same workbook ,请使用HSSFWorkbook.clonesheet(int sheetIndex)
Ivan的评论将复制问题与工作簿相关联 .
是的,这可以......这是我的代码 .
XSSFWorkbook workbook = new XSSFWorkbook(file); int totalRecords = 5; for (int i = 0; i < totalRecords - 1; i++) { workbook.cloneSheet(1); } for (int i = 1; i <= totalRecords; i++) { workbook.setSheetName(i, "S" + i); }
3 回答
您可能需要工作簿上的cloneSheet(sheetNumber)方法 . 有关详细信息,请参阅JavaDocs
你检查了API吗?
要将工作表复制到 same workbook ,请使用HSSFWorkbook.clonesheet(int sheetIndex)
Ivan的评论将复制问题与工作簿相关联 .
是的,这可以......这是我的代码 .